Enguerrand III De was born about 1182 in Of,Boves,Somme,France.  Enguerrand III De's father was Raoul I de Marle Sir De Coucy and his mother was Alix De DREUX.  His paternal grandparents were Enguerrand II Lord of De Coucy and Agnes DE BEAUGENCY; his maternal grandparents were Robert Count of Dreux and Agnes Ctsse de Baudemont. He had three brothers and three sisters, named Thomas II De, Raoul De, Robert I De, Yolande, Isabeau de Coucy and Agnes De.  He was the third oldest of the seven children. He had three half-sisters named Yolande de, Isabeau De and Ade De.  He died in 1242.


Enguerrand III De's first family with Beatrix De VIGNORY

‌Enguerrand III De and Beatrix De were married in a religious ceremony about 1201 in Vignory,Haute-Marne,France.


Enguerrand III De's second family with Marie de Montmirel-En-Brie

‌Enguerrand III De and Marie de were married in a religious ceremony about 1210 in Oisy,Aisne,France.  They had three sons and three daughters, named Raoul II De, Jean De, Enguerrand IV Count Of, Alix De, Jeanne De and Marie De.
